What are marshmallows fluff made of?

Fluff’s ingredients include corn syrup, sugar syrup, vanilla flavor, and egg whites. Fluff continues to be a regional tradition in the Northeastern United States.

Can vegetarians eat marshmallow fluff?

No, marshmallow fluff is not fully vegan, because it contains egg whites. However, unlike traditionally made marshmallow, marshmallow fluff is gelatin-free. Nowadays, some brands are producing vegan marshmallow crème to incorporate people who follow a plant-based diet or are allergic to eggs.

Are old marshmallows safe to eat?

Do Marshmallows Expire? Marshmallows do expire, although it does take quite a while for them to spoil and go bad. After this best-by date, the marshmallows might begin to lose their light, fluffy texture, and start to harden and lose their taste. They should still be safe to eat, though.

How long does it take to whip marshmallow cream?

When the sugar mixture reaches 240 degrees, remove from heat. With your mixer on low, slowly add sugar mixture to the egg whites. Once all of the sugar mixture is added, turn the mixer to medium-high and whip until stiff peaks form, about 7-9 minutes.
